Released December 25th, 1963, 'The Orgy at Lil's Place' stars Kari Knudsen, Davee Decker, Joyce Bonner, Terry Powers The R mov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 17 min, and received a user score of 50 (out of 100) on TMDb, which assembled reviews from 8 experienced users.

Curious to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Two sisters get involved in nude modeling for artists." .
